As a Principal AI Engineer, you will join the AI team to architect and implement advanced systems that address complex analytical challenges within the financial data ecosystem. You will design end-to-end ML pipelines for multi-modal data sources, including structured market data and unstructured documents, while developing NLP systems to extract metrics from millions of reports. Your daily work involves building conversational AI platforms using LLMs, semantic search, and retrieval-augmented generation techniques. To succeed, you must possess expertise in PyTorch, TensorFlow, LangChain, and Langflow, alongside experience with Azure or GCP cloud-native infrastructure. You will also implement MLOps best practices, manage distributed inference pipelines, and establish CI/CD pipelines for generative AI services. This role focuses on solving sophisticated problems in risk assessment, portfolio analytics, and market dynamics to provide actionable insights for global investors.
